LSE gains 70.24 points

LAHORE: Lahore Stock Exchange witnessed bullish trend by gaining 70.24 points, as the LSE Index-25 opened with 4840.57 points and closed at 4910.81 points.

The market’s overall situation, however, did not correspond to an upward trend as it remained at 2.759 million shares to close against previous turnover of 3.225 million shares, showing a downward slide of 466,000 shares. While, out of the total 112 active scrips 39 moved up, 8 shed values and 65 remained equal.

Major gainers of the day were Pakistan State Oil Company Limited, Century Paper and Board Mills Limited, Fauji Fertilizer Bin Qasim Limited by recording increase in their per share value by Rs 5.51,  Rs 2.57 and Rs 2.13 respectively.

Adamjee Insurance Company Limited, Nishat (Chunian) Limited and Nishat Mills Limited lost their per share value by Rs 1.69, Rs 1.12 and Re 0.70 respectively.
Top three volume leaders of the day included The Bank of Punjab Limited with 494,000 shares, NIB Bank Limited with 452,000 shares and Pakistan International Airline Corporation with 324,000 shares.
